#9ba6fc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9ba6fc is composed of 60.8% red, 65.1%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.5% cyan, 34.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 233.2 degrees, a saturation of 94.2% and a lightness of 79.8%. #9ba6fc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#374df9.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

#9ba6fc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9ba6fc has RGB values of R:155, G:166, B:252 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0.34,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 10200828.

Shades and Tints of #9ba6fc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00020e is the darkest color, while #fafb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#9ba6fc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cbcbcc is the less saturated color, while #9ba6fc is the most saturated one.
